Kids at the Boys and Girls Club of Kootenai County received new summer shoes Monday from Rick Case Automotive Group, which provided over 600 pairs plus 1,000 socks; 40 volunteers helped more than 450 kids get fitted shoes with extra pairs set aside for children joining in July.
The Wassmuth Center for Human Rights marked its 30th anniversary this weekend by hosting community reflections on three decades of promoting human dignity and expanding free education programs.
The ninth annual Hayden Lake Classic Boat Show will take place Sunday, June 28 at Hayden Lake Marina docks (10 a.m. to 1 p.m.) and is free to all, featuring U.S. and Canadian mahogany speedboats that showcase timeless craftsmanship.
Students from Kellogg and Wallace High Schools participate in the Confluence Project— a yearlong water science program that connects hands-on fieldwork with research on local waterways and snowpack measurements at Lookout Pass.
Sponsored by the University of Idaho, the program prepares them for future stewardship.
